Re: SVI3206D Hybrid IC ( BC POWER MODULE BY SANYO)
'1' are NPN (Collectors of both Transistor '1' are connected to +VCC pin 4)
'4' are PNP (Collectors of both transistors are connected -VCC pin 5)

Re: SVI3206D Hybrid IC ( BC POWER MODULE BY SANYO)
according to diagram of SVI ,
pin3=ch1 out
Pin4 = +60V
Pin5 = -60V
pin6 =ch2 out
so on my ''mspaint artwork''
both yellow 1'S marks Are +60V
Both Red 4's marks Are -60V
Both Orange 3's marks Are channel 1 Output
And
Both Green 2's Marks Are Channel 2 Output
it leave 4 Connection that is for the signal
